The INSIGHT Act amends ERISA so the Employee Benefit Security Administration must send yearly reports to Congress about the status of its investigations and any written agreements where the Secretary provides adverse assistance to individuals. It also adds a congressional finding that supports voluntary private pension plans. The reports must protect the privacy of plan sponsors, fiduciaries, employees and participants.
